2. Return Sauce Recipe
Comeback Sauce … The essential southerly dipping sauce served with everything from deep-fried oysters to raw veggies.It’s a pauper’s remoulade, made with mayo, ketchup, hot sauce, and a pair various other well-selected active ingredients.

3. Dual Beer Battered Cajun
Never take too lightly the power of a good french fry. It can transform your day, heck, maybe even your life!
While I am pretty confident in my mashed potato making skills, this was really my first time trying to make home made french fries. I’ve gained from a few of my favored restaurants that serve remarkable truffle french fries that the «secret» to making a crunchy fry is saturating them in ice water. This eliminates the starch, so they fry up much better and also crispier.

7. Boudin Balls
Boudin balls are a mix of prepared rice, pork, onions, green peppers, and also seasonings rolled in panko breadcrumbs as well as fried up until golden brown.
